Transaction f2ec60f8fa77b64e75f27a5ce4647ef9c206668948879b7c4751698d694aee29
1 Input
2 Outputs
- f2ec60f8fa77b64e75f27a5ce4647ef9c206668948879b7c4751698d694aee29:0
- f2ec60f8fa77b64e75f27a5ce4647ef9c206668948879b7c4751698d694aee29:1
value 33000000
address 1EfVAEwkWiw8eRHySR7NMRu1Kn9XN6gyVk
value 7063050
address 18qsJYWyGx66pFfF41PabzGbM6wdiTLsLU